Q1 26/27 earnings summary

21 Jul, 2026

Executive summary

  • Q1 FY27 revenue grew 10% YoY to ₹559.3 crore, with order inflow up 218% and order book rising 26% YoY to ₹6,630 crore, providing strong medium-term visibility.

  • Major orders included a landmark ₹1,000+ crore PGCIL contract, significant domestic and export wins, and a healthy pipeline of ₹23,000 crore in inquiries.

  • Capacity utilization was temporarily impacted by Changodar expansion, expected to normalize from Q3 FY27 as new facilities stabilize.

  • Backward integration projects are underway to secure 80%-85% of raw material needs in-house, enhancing supply chain resilience and margins.

  • Management reaffirmed FY27 guidance: 25% revenue growth, 16% EBITDA margin, and 9%-10% PAT margin.

Financial highlights

  • Standalone Q1 FY27 revenue: ₹559.3 crore (+10% YoY); EBITDA: ₹87.4 crore (15.6% margin); PAT: ₹49.9 crore (8.9% margin).

  • Consolidated Q1 FY27 revenue: ₹572.34 crore (up 8% YoY); EBITDA: ₹109.7 crore (19.2% margin); PAT: ₹64.29 crore.

  • Five-year standalone CAGR: revenue 27%, EBITDA 38%, PAT 101%.

  • Standalone debt at ₹424 crore (FY26), debt-to-equity 0.3x, debt/EBITDA 1.1x.

  • Cash and bank balance at FY26: ₹139 crore; ₹145 crore QIP proceeds earmarked for integration projects.

Outlook and guidance

  • FY27 targets: 25% revenue growth, 16% EBITDA margin, 9%-10% PAT margin.

  • Consolidated EBITDA margin expected at 20%-21% for FY27.

  • $1 billion revenue target by FY29, with ₹8,000 crore as the revised rupee equivalent.

  • Backward integration to add 200-300 bps to margins from FY28 as new facilities come online.

  • Project expansion and backward integration to be completed by Q1 FY28, supporting future growth.
